Part Six
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
"Hold on, she's coming out of it," Willow said, taking Buffy's hand as she noticed the Slayer opening her eyes. "You okay, Buff?"
"I've...felt better..." Buffy muttered, moving her other hand to her head.
"Understandably so," Giles commented.
"Who - "
"Xander," Willow replied, anticipating her question. "I guess his 'Angel-paranoia' comes in handy sometimes. Just after you left, so did he. Said he thought that creature might attack again."
"Of course, it was quite obvious that he simply didn't trust Angel," Giles added. "I don't think he'll ever really get past it."
"Not after this, anyway," Buffy groaned as she sat up. "How is he?"
"Xander? Don't think I've ever seen him happier."
"I meant Angel."
"Oh. Well...uh..."
"Buffy, I don't really think you should see him at the moment," Giles interceded.
"I've got a right to!"
"Yes, of course, but it just might be better for all concerned if - "
"Giles."
"All right. Fine."
"Don't say he didn't warn you," Willow advised, helping her up.
In grim silence, they directed Buffy over to the weapons locker, the corner of the library that was blocked off by barred screens and used for storing various implements of destruction. It had been employed more than once as a holding pen for demons, vampires or the like. Now, the weapons had been evacuated, and in their place was a small, makeshift bed, which Angel lay on, quite still, staring at the ceiling. She could see that he had been tied down. A large padlock was on the door, and Xander stood guard with a dutiful expression.
"He's conscious again," Xander reported as they approached.
"It's about time," Cordelia commented. "You must've hit him pretty hard."
"Hey, I saved Buffy's life," Xander protested. "Who cares whether I hit him hard or not?!"
"Nobody's questioning your actions, Xander," Giles quickly cut in, glaring at Cordelia.
"Except the part where you came back gloating," Willow muttered under her breath.
"Let me in," something lumped in Buffy's throat as she gave the order.
"Uh...do you think that's really smart, Buff?"
"Just do it, Xander."
"You're the Slayer." Shrugging, Xander took out the key and unlocked Angel's prison.
Buffy felt tears threaten as she entered. Flushing, she turned away from the others. "Hey. A little privacy, you guys?"
"Yes, of course," Giles ushered the others away.
"But - " Xander began.
"She's a big girl now," Willow silenced him. "She can take care of herself."
"Yeah," he grunted, "like she did before."
Ignoring their comments, Buffy moved to Angel's bedside, wondering if he would still react as he had to her. As it was, he didn't move at all, just continued to fix his gaze upward.
"Angel?"
"Don't come near me, Buffy. " He firmly closed his eyes. "You know what I did."
"You weren't yourself then! Angel, I - Angel, look at me, please."
"Don't ask me to, Buffy," he shook his head, slowly. "I want to, but I can't. You can't let me. Make sure I can't, Buffy."
"I won't. It's okay. You're going to be all right, Angel." After a moment of thought, she reached up and pulled away the hastily applied strip of bandage around her head, and tied it over his eyes, making an effective blindfold.
"There's blood on this," Angel observed. "Is it yours?"
"Angel - "
"Is it yours?!"
"Yes."
"Did I do it?"
"Yes."
He swore, then turned his face toward her.
"That's why I can't look at you..." he said. "...I already know what I'll see..."
"What?" she asked. "What will you see? You have to tell me, Angel."
"I can't..." he began to struggle against his bonds. Buffy bit her lip, another tear falling, and wondered if it was his intent, or someone else's. "I can't say...it's too...too...it hurts...too much..."
"Shhh," she soothed, placing a hand on his chest. "Relax. It's okay."
"No...you said...I have to tell you..." he breathed heavily, forcing out the words.
"Not if it hurts you." Her voice was choked with emotion. "Nothing matters more than you."
"I can see her...hurting you..." he continued, ignoring her, "...not killing you...but I can hear you screaming...and I can't reach her...I can't reach you..."
"Angel - "
His fingers were beginning to turn white, the muscles along his arms taught and trembling with the strain of...of what? Was he trying to break free, or trying to stop himself from doing so?
"You scream my name..." his voice stepped up in volume and intensity as he spoke, and by the end of his sentence, he was shouting. "You scream it over and over again...and the others are all dead...and I can't save you...but I can hear you, over and over...I have to kill her, Buffy! I have to! Let me go! I have to kill her!"
"Angel!" the tears were a torrent, and her own voice practically a scream, as she gripped his shoulders with both hands, trying to hold him still. "Stop it! Just stop it, Angel! I'm here! I'm okay! She can't hurt me!"
"But I can see her," he choked out weakly, his struggles slowly coming to a halt.
"Listen to me, Angel. Nobody's hurting me. Something's wrong with you. Once I find out what it is, you'll be back to normal, and - "
"I hit you, didn't I?" Angel asked, suddenly calm again. "We fought. I almost killed you."
She didn't answer. She couldn't bring herself to.
"Buffy, if I try to hurt you again, do whatever you need to. Kill me, if that's what it takes."
"No..."
"I love you." He seemed suddenly exhausted as, deprived of his sight, he found her face with his hands and kissed her. "Nothing matters more than you."
She gently moved her hand along the lines of his face, barely touching him, and kissed him back, wondering if he noticed her tears on his forehead as she did so.
"Remember," he repeated weakly as she rose to leave. "Do whatever you have to."
"I love you," she whispered through tears, but she was somehow sure he couldn't hear her.
